有限元法在地铁车站坑底加固技术中的应用

摘    要:在软土地区的一些深基坑工程中,坑底加固可以减少围护结构的水平位移及对周边环境的影响,降低坑底隆起和坑底承压水突涌的风险。由于坑底加固的选择往往造成工程造价的增大,利用有限元法对坑底加固方案进行技术优化就十分有必要。针对地铁车站基坑,模型选用了适合土体开挖的Hardening-Soil本构模型。通过对计算出的地表沉降、地墙的水平位移和坑底隆起的比较分析,提出了一些合理建议。

关 键 词:地铁车站  深基坑  加固  有限元  坑底隆起
